Something I noticed with this box is using bluetooth earbuds/headphones. When you change the channel, it goes out of sync like watching an old karate movie. I tried 3 different pairs, one of them is Bose, so hopefully that is something that can be fixed.

I picked a pair up today I had same issue and changed my media player to my seconday and it works fine
squirtNcider
02-25-2018, 05:29 PM
How do you change to a secondary media player?
nobodyspecial
02-25-2018, 05:38 PM
when in live tv ,hit the menu,scroll down to player..........
squirtNcider
02-26-2018, 12:05 AM
Thanks a ton.....Worked like a charm!
